Arvados-DCO-1.1-Signed-off-by: Tom Clegg <tom@curii.com>
return err
}
resp, err := http.DefaultClient.Do(req)
return err
}
resp, err := http.DefaultClient.Do(req)
+ if err == nil {
+ defer resp.Body.Close()
+ }
if errServe, _ := errServe.Load().(error); errServe != nil {
// If server already exited, return that error
// (probably "can't listen"), not the request error.
if errServe, _ := errServe.Load().(error); errServe != nil {
// If server already exited, return that error
// (probably "can't listen"), not the request error.